Bemetara: A 99-year-old man was vaccinated against COVID-19 on Tuesday in Chhattisgarh's Bemetara district.

Yuvraj Singh Patel, a resident of Padmi village, was given the first jab of the vaccine at the Bemetara District Hospital.

Patel, who will turn a centenarian on June 8, also praised the facility at the hospital and urged everyone to get vaccinated.

Chief Medical Officer Dr Satish Kumar Sharma informed that so far 2,737 elderly people have been vaccinated in the Bemetara district.

He further said that besides Bemetara District Hospital, people are also being vaccinated at Nawagarh Berla Community Health Center in the district.

It is worth mentioning here that after the government's announcement, people above 60 years of age and those over 45 years with comorbidities are being vaccinated across the country from March 1 for free at government facilities and for a charge at many private hospitals.
